#2164 Post by Llessur2002 » Fri May 05, 2017 4:53 pm

Patrick_27 wrote:I don't think it'll be H&M, if you look at their footprint everywhere else in Australia, even with such a large chunk of this building it doesn't match what they have elsewhere... Seems more in-line with TopShop but then they're in Myer...
Depending on what you read on t'interweb, H&M on Bourke Street Mall is between 4500 and 5000 square metres, spread over three levels. The retail areas (i.e. not including service cores, stairs etc) of Levels 1 and 2 of RMP are about 3,200 square metres each. The combined total of the ground floor units as they stand at the moment is about 1000 square metres. The mezzanine would presumably be the same size - that's 8400 square metres in total.

Obviously space for stock would be an issue as I think the mezzanine is currently used for this. Based on their maze-like Bourke Street store, I can't see why H&M would object to using Ground, Mezzanine and First floors as retail space (5,200 square metres as it stands) and using Level 2 for stock.

If Level 1 isn't taken into account (i.e. only the ground floor and mezzanine levels are being redeveloped) then that's still 2000 square metres in total, which is about the size of H&M's Pacific Werribee store, but I agree it seems on the small side.
